Environmental Effect of Liquid Waste



Fluid garbage disposal substantially affects the atmosphere, with effects that can be both instant and durable. When fluid waste is poorly managed, it can bring about extreme contamination of dirt, rivers, and air. Poisonous materials typically present in fluid waste, such as hefty metals, pesticides, and organic solvents, can leach right into the ground, presenting dangers to environments and human health.


The immediate results of fluid waste disposal include eutrophication, where nutrient-rich waste advertises extreme algae growth in water bodies. This process depletes oxygen levels, causing the death of aquatic life and disturbance of neighborhood biodiversity. Moreover, the leaching of harmful chemicals into groundwater can compromise drinking water products, producing long-term carcinogen for neighborhoods.


Lasting consequences of inadequate fluid waste administration consist of environment degradation and loss of biodiversity. Sensitive ecological communities, such as marshes and rivers, are specifically prone, as they rely upon clean water to sustain diverse vegetation and fauna. Efficient Disposal Approaches



When thinking about reliable disposal techniques for fluid waste, it is critical to carry out strategies that minimize ecological impact while ensuring public wellness safety and security. Chemical treatments, including coagulation and neutralization, can provide hazardous materials inert, while physical methods like filtering or sedimentation aid separate solid particulates from fluids.


In addition, incineration is an efficient disposal technique for particular fluid wastes, especially those that are flammable or extremely hazardous. This process converts waste into ash, gases, and warm, substantially reducing the quantity of waste while reducing risks associated with storage space.


Furthermore, secure landfilling of treated fluid waste can be a sensible option when various other methods are not practical. Guaranteeing that garbage dumps are designed with liners and leachate collection systems aids prevent contamination of groundwater and surrounding ecological communities.
